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
70 30953 70835633645
05 10 57221360242
05 10 57221360242
048 97616 04600640
All about undefined
Interested in learning more?
05 10 57221360242
048 97616 04600640
See more
7660945448 473456553 2626
0577 123 243822 388985412
See more
96232 7800 722960
921 9550361638 18101680945 36
See more